WebAssessment At the end of the CITB SMSTS course delegates are required to sit an exam paper consisting of 25 questions, of which 5 are safety critical and require a short written answer. Multiple choice questions are worth 1 point each and safety critical questions are worth 1-3 points each. hk bureauWebThe SMSTS course is also available through Remote Learning, where delegates can complete training and gain their certification via Virtual Classrooms.
